ThermalTake's LUXA2 brand has introduced the H1-Touch, a new stand designed for iPhone, iPod and PDA-like devices.
LUXA2, a Division of Thermaltake, was created in 2009, with characteristics of simplicity, luxury, and a unique lifestyle. The core design theory of LUXA2 starts from simple shapes blending with luxury elements, which create the unique lifestyle for different segments.

Following this design concept, H1-Touch is designed for Creative Pros, Mobile Bloggers, Leisure Seekers, Hip Newbies, Entertainment Junkies, and Apple's Mac Lovers.

With six support levers, adjustable from 45 mm to 72 mm, the H1-Touch can hold the iPhone, iPod Touch, or even PDAs and smart phones available on the market today.

Furthermore, it’s equipped a with 360-degree angle adjustable dock for different viewing angles. It can move freely either rotate vertically or horizontally; or flip towards the side, so that you and your friends can have fun together.
